DSPIC33FJ64GP204-I/PT Product Overview
The DSPIC33FJ64GP204-I/PT is a Microchip general-purpose 16-bit Digital Signal Controller (DSC) in a 44-lead TQFP package, designed for 3.3V embedded control applications requiring large memory, rich peripherals, and high-speed processing. Based on the dsPIC33F core running at 40 MIPS, the DSPIC33FJ64GP204-I/PT integrates 64KB Flash and 8KB SRAM, providing ample storage for complex algorithms, real-time data buffers, and communication stacks. On-chip peripherals include five 16-bit timers, four input captures, four output compares/PWM, a 10-bit ADC (up to 1.1 Msps, up to 13 analog input channels), and three analog comparators. Communication interfaces provide 2× UART, 1× SPI, and 1× I2C, with Peripheral Pin Select (PPS) for flexible digital pin mapping. Operating from 3.0V to 3.6V with an industrial temperature range of -40°C to +85°C, in a TQFP-44 package. The DSPIC33FJ64GP204-I/PT is ideal for general embedded control, industrial automation, data acquisition systems, communication gateways, and real-time control systems that require efficient DSP capability, large memory, and moderate I/O density.

- What does the “-I/PT” suffix mean?
- -I: Industrial temperature range (-40°C to +85°C) for the DSPIC33FJ64GP204-I/PT.
- /PT: 44-lead TQFP package.
- How does it differ from the DSIC33FJ32GP202 and motor-control series?
- Positioning: The DSPIC33FJ64GP204-I/PT is general-purpose; GP202 is also general-purpose but with fewer pins; MC series targets motor control; GS series targets digital power.
- Memory: The DSPIC33FJ64GP204-I/PT has 64KB Flash and 8KB SRAM, doubling the GP202 (32KB/4KB), suiting more complex algorithms.
- PWM: 4 output compare/PWM, no dedicated motor-control PWM module (no complementary outputs or dead-time).
- I/Os: TQFP-44 provides up to 35 I/Os, significantly more than SOIC-28.
- Use cases: The DSPIC33FJ64GP204-I/PT excels in general control needing large memory and many I/Os; MC for high-performance motor control.

- Can it be used to control motors?
The DSPIC33FJ64GP204-I/PT's four output compares can generate simple PWM signals for brushed DC or stepper motors (with external drivers). However, it lacks complementary outputs and dead-time insertion, making it unsuitable for high-performance BLDC/PMSM control. For dedicated motor control, the dsPIC33F MC series is recommended. - What development tools and software are supported?
